COOKEVILLE, Tenn. – The Tennessee Tech baseball team and head coach Matt Bragga announced the return of the renowned Golden Eagle Baseball Camps. A trio of high school camps will be offered in the fall, with a few others expected to be announced at a later time.

First up will be the Golden Eagle Baseball Camp, set to take place at Quillen Field and Bush Stadium at the Averitt Express Baseball Complex on Saturday, Aug. 20. The first camp of the fall is open to participants from 9th through 12th grade and will begin at 10:00 a.m. CT. 

Next on the docket is the Labor Day Elite High School Camp, featuring a 9:00 a.m. start on Monday, Sept. 5 at Quillen Field. The camp is open from 9th through 12th grade.

Also announced is the Friday Night Lights Fall Prospect Camp. Set for 6:00 p.m. on Friday, Sept. 30, the camp will be open to 9th through 12th graders and take place at Bush Stadium.
